Full Recipe

For the wet ingredients:

  • 1 ⅓ to 1 ½ cups mashed overripe bananas (about 3 to 4 bananas)

  • ½ cup vegetable oil

  • ¾ cup granulated sugar

  • 2 large eggs

  • 1 teaspoon vanilla extract

For the dry ingredients:

  • 2 cups all-purpose flour

  • 1 teaspoon baking soda

  • ½ teaspoon baking powder

  • ½ teaspoon cinnamon

  • ½ teaspoon salt

For the add-ins:

  • 1 ½ cups semi-sweet chocolate chips (mini or regular)

Directions

Step 1: Preheat the Oven

Preheat your oven to 350°F (175°C). Grease a loaf pan (either 9×5 or 8.5×4.5 inches) with non-stick cooking spray, or line it with parchment paper to prevent sticking.

Step 2: Mash the Bananas

In a medium-sized mixing bowl, mash the overripe bananas with a potato masher or fork until they are smooth, leaving small chunks for texture. Measure the mashed bananas to ensure you have 1 ⅓ to 1 ½ cups.

Step 3: Mix the Wet Ingredients

In a separate large bowl, combine the mashed bananas, vegetable oil, sugar, eggs, and vanilla extract. Stir the mixture until all the ingredients are well incorporated.

Step 4: Add the Dry Ingredients

In a small bowl, whisk together the flour, baking soda, baking powder, cinnamon, and salt. Gradually add the dry ingredients to the wet ingredients, mixing gently with a spatula or spoon until just combined. Be careful not to overmix the batter to ensure a soft, moist bread.

Step 5: Fold in the Chocolate Chips

Add the chocolate chips to the batter and gently fold them in using a spatula. You can use regular semi-sweet chocolate chips, mini chips, or even milk chocolate chips, depending on your preference.

Step 6: Bake the Banana Bread

Pour the batter into the prepared loaf pan and spread it out evenly. Bake for 45-60 minutes, or until the top is golden brown and a toothpick inserted into the center of the bread comes out clean. If the top begins to brown too quickly, cover the bread with aluminum foil and continue baking until the center is fully cooked.

Step 7: Cool and Serve

Allow the banana bread to cool in the pan for about 10 minutes, then transfer it to a wire rack to cool completely. Slice and enjoy this decadent treat with a cup of coffee, tea, or milk.

Nutrients per Serving

Each slice of Chocolate Chip Banana Bread contains approximately:

  • Calories: 290 kcal

  • Carbohydrates: 38g

  • Protein: 4g

  • Fat: 15g

  • Saturated Fat: 2g

  • Cholesterol: 30mg

  • Sodium: 220mg

  • Potassium: 230mg

  • Fiber: 2g

  • Sugar: 21g

  • Vitamin A: 75 IU

  • Vitamin C: 3mg

  • Calcium: 18mg

  • Iron: 1mg

Making the Best Chocolate Chip Banana Bread

To make the best Chocolate Chip Banana Bread, there are a few tips and techniques to keep in mind. First, it’s important to use ripe bananas. Overripe bananas are softer and sweeter, which makes them ideal for baking. The more brown spots the bananas have, the better. You can even freeze bananas when they get too ripe and thaw them when you’re ready to bake.

Another tip is not to overmix the batter. When adding the dry ingredients to the wet ingredients, mix just until everything is combined. Overmixing can lead to a denser, tougher loaf, which isn’t ideal for banana bread. The batter should be thick and slightly lumpy, but not smooth, as the mashed bananas should be visible in the mixture.

For an extra indulgent touch, feel free to add a few more chocolate chips on top before baking. This will create a nice melt-in-your-mouth chocolate layer on top of the bread once baked. The addition of a pinch of cinnamon or nutmeg to the batter can also add a subtle spice that complements the banana flavor beautifully. For those who enjoy nuts, adding a cup of walnuts or pecans to the batter provides an added crunch and pairs wonderfully with the banana and chocolate.
